Home
last modified time | relevance | path

Searched refs:kernel_end (Results 1 – 10 of 10) sorted by relevance

/arch/s390/boot/compressed/
Dmisc.c145 void *output, *kernel_end; in decompress_kernel() local
148 kernel_end = output + SZ__bss_start; in decompress_kernel()
149 check_ipl_parmblock((void *) 0, (unsigned long) kernel_end); in decompress_kernel()
158 if (INITRD_START && INITRD_SIZE && kernel_end > (void *) INITRD_START) { in decompress_kernel()
159 check_ipl_parmblock(kernel_end, INITRD_SIZE); in decompress_kernel()
160 memmove(kernel_end, (void *) INITRD_START, INITRD_SIZE); in decompress_kernel()
161 INITRD_START = (unsigned long) kernel_end; in decompress_kernel()
/arch/arm/boot/bootp/
Dkernel.S4 .globl kernel_end symbol
5 kernel_end: label
/arch/alpha/mm/
Dinit.c144 callback_init(void * kernel_end) in callback_init() argument
181 (((unsigned long)kernel_end + ~PAGE_MASK) & PAGE_MASK); in callback_init()
182 kernel_end = two_pages + 2*PAGE_SIZE; in callback_init()
217 memset(kernel_end, 0, PAGE_SIZE); in callback_init()
219 pmd_set(pmd, (pte_t *)kernel_end); in callback_init()
220 kernel_end += PAGE_SIZE; in callback_init()
231 return kernel_end; in callback_init()
Dnuma.c55 setup_memory_node(int nid, void *kernel_end) in setup_memory_node() argument
152 end_kernel_pfn = PFN_UP(virt_to_phys(kernel_end)); in setup_memory_node()
251 setup_memory(void *kernel_end) in setup_memory() argument
262 setup_memory_node(nid, kernel_end); in setup_memory()
/arch/mips/ar7/
Dmemory.c38 u32 *kernel_end = (u32 *)KSEG1ADDR(CPHYSADDR((u32)&_end)); in memsize() local
41 while (tmpaddr > kernel_end) { in memsize()
/arch/powerpc/kernel/
Dmachine_kexec.c198 static phys_addr_t kernel_end; variable
206 .value = &kernel_end,
273 kernel_end = cpu_to_be_ulong(__pa(_end)); in kexec_setup()
/arch/alpha/kernel/
Dsetup.c309 setup_memory(void *kernel_end) in setup_memory() argument
366 end_kernel_pfn = PFN_UP(virt_to_phys(kernel_end)); in setup_memory()
514 void *kernel_end = _end; /* end of kernel */ in setup_arch() local
553 kernel_end = callback_init(kernel_end); in setup_arch()
709 setup_memory(kernel_end); in setup_arch()
/arch/x86/mm/
Dinit.c549 unsigned long kernel_end = __pa_symbol(_end); in init_mem_mapping() local
558 memory_map_bottom_up(kernel_end, end); in init_mem_mapping()
559 memory_map_bottom_up(ISA_END_ADDRESS, kernel_end); in init_mem_mapping()
/arch/m68k/kernel/
Dhead.S1285 movel %pc@(L(kernel_end)),%a0
2542 lea %pc@(L(kernel_end)),%a0
3786 L(kernel_end):
/arch/x86/xen/
Dmmu.c1145 unsigned long kernel_end = roundup((unsigned long)_brk_end, PMD_SIZE) - 1; in xen_cleanhighmap() local
1154 if (vaddr < (unsigned long) _text || vaddr > kernel_end) in xen_cleanhighmap()